Output 2d80870c4ae265b66b79dfaff74685cd556ea6e6349ef823b3bcae8a797553e1:28

value
720299
script pubkey
OP_0 OP_PUSHBYTES_20 b11612e8fb9d453f7ad20255100a1b291b3638ce
address
bc1qkytp968mn4zn77kjqf23qzsm9ydnvwxw6jt0fv
transaction
2d80870c4ae265b66b79dfaff74685cd556ea6e6349ef823b3bcae8a797553e1
confirmations
1587
spent
true